Understanding Pennies and Dimes

Introducing children to the value of money is a practical skill that builds mathematical thinking. Pennies and dimes are often the first coins young learners encounter, offering a hands-on way to explore counting, place value, and basic arithmetic. These coins help bridge concrete experiences with abstract concepts, making them a staple in early education.

Pennies and dimes differ in appearance and worth. A penny is a copper-colored coin with a smooth edge, bearing the profile of Abraham Lincoln and the Lincoln Memorial. A dime, though smaller, is silver-colored with a ridged edge and features Franklin D. Roosevelt. Recognizing these differences is the first step in learning to count and combine them.

The Value of Each Coin

Before counting, children must understand what each coin represents. A penny is worth one cent, while a dime is worth ten cents. This ten-to-one relationship is crucial because it introduces a foundational place value concept: ten ones make one ten. When teaching, emphasize that a single dime has the same value as ten pennies. This comparison helps children see that larger coin denominations can simplify counting.

For example, if a child has 15 cents, they can represent it as one dime and five pennies (10 + 5) rather than fifteen individual pennies. This shift from counting by ones to counting by tens is a key milestone in mathematical development.

Counting with Confidence

Learning to count coins requires practice and strategy. Start with pennies alone, having children count by ones. Once they are comfortable, introduce dimes and teach counting by tens. Combining both coins involves switching between counting methods. Begin with the dimes, counting by tens, then add the pennies by ones.

For instance, if a child has three dimes and four pennies, they count: 10, 20, 30 (for the dimes), then 31, 32, 33, 34 (adding the pennies). This process reinforces the idea that dimes represent the tens place and pennies represent the ones place. Many 2nd grade teachers explore this strategy to build number sense.
